Abstract :
The authors examine several head-of-line selection schemes by means of computer simulation. The problem of the unfair allocation of the switching bandwidth to the input ports of an Asynchronous Transfer Mode (ATM) switching system is investigated. A generic nonblocking packet switch is assumed. The switching fabric has input and output buffers and employs a backpressure mechanism to prevent output buffer overflow. The performance of these schemes under random and bursty traffic is evaluated
